INTENSity™ Micro Combo is a portable electrotherapy device featuring four therapeutic modes : Transcutaneous Electrical Nerve Stimulation (TENS) and Microcurrent (MIC), which are used for pain relief and electrical muscle stimulation. The stimulator sends gentle electrical current to underlying nerves and muscle groups via electrodes applied on the skin. The parameters of the device are controlled by the buttons on the front panel. The intensity level is adjustable according to the needs of patients.

EXPLANATION OF PAIN

Pain is a warning system and the body’s method of telling us that something is wrong. Pain is important; without it abnormal conditions may go detected, causing damage or injury to vital parts of our bodies. Even though pain is a necessary warning signal of trauma or malfunction in the body, nature may have gone t0o far in its design. Aside from its value i diagnosis, long-lasting persistent pain serves no useful purpose. Pain does not begin until the coded message travels to the brain where it is decoded, analyzed, and then reacted to. The pain message travels from the injured area along the small nerves leading to the spinal cord. Here the message is switched to different nerves that travel up the spinal cord to the brain. The pain message is then interpreted, referred back and the pain s felt.

EXPLANATION OF TENS

Transcutaneous Electrical Nerve Stimulation (TENS) is a non- invasive, drug free method of controlling pain. TENS uses tiny electrical impulses sent through the skin to nerves to modify your pain perception. TENS does not cure any physiological problem; it only helps control the pain. TENS does not work for everyone; however, in most patients it is effective in reducing or eliminating the pain, allowing for a return to normal activity.

HOW TENS WORKS

There is nothing “magic” about Transcutaneous Electrical Nerve Stimulation (TENS). TENS is intended to be used to relieve pain. The TENS unit sends comfortable impulses through the skin that stimulate the nerve (or nerves) in the treatment area. In many cases, this stimulation will greatly reduce or eliminate the pain sensation the patient feels. Pain relief varies by individual patient, mode selected for therapy, and the type of pain. In many patients, the reduction or elimination of pain lasts longer than the actual period of stimulation (sometimes as much as three to four times. fonger). In others, pain is only modified while stimulation actually Occurs. You may discuss this with your physician or therapist.

WHAT IS MICROCURRENT?

currentis sent into the cells of the body. Microcurrent is a very faint current that is so small it is measured in millionths of an amp (Microamps). Human cells generate a current that is in the micro amp range which is why you can’t feel it – the current is so low it doesn’t stimulate the sensory nerves. Microcurrent is a physiological electric modality that increases ATP (energy) production in the cells of your body. This dramatically increases the tissue’s healing rate. The immediate response to the correct microcurrent frequency suggests that other mechanisms are involved as well. The exact effects or changes in the tissue are unmistakable; scars will often suddenly soften; trigger points often become less painful within minutes when the “correct” frequency is applied. In many situations the changes seen seem to be long lasting and in many cases permanent

Technical specifications for Transcutaneous Electrical Nerve Stimulator (TENS) mode

Waveform Mono-phase square pulse wave
**** Pulse Amplitude Adjustable, 0~105mA peak at 1000 ohm load each channel,

1mA/step
Pulse Width| Adjustable from 50 to 300µs, 10µs/step
Pulse Rate| Adjustable, from 1 to 150 Hz, 1 Hz/step
Burst (B)| Burst rate: Adjustable, 0.5 ~ 5Hz Pulse width adjustable, 50~300µS Frequency fixed = 100 Hz
Normal (N)| The pulse rate and pulse width are adjustable. It generates continuous stimulation based on the setting value.
Pulse Width Modulation (M)| The pulse width is automatically varied in a cycle time. The pulse width is decreased from its original setting to 60% in setting cycle time, and then increased from 60% to its original setting in the next setting cycle time. In this program, pulse rate (1 to 150Hz), pulse width (50 to 300µS) and cycle time (5 to 30 sec) are fully adjustable.
**** Pulse Rate Modulation (M1)| The pulse rate is automatically carried in a cycle time. The pulse rate is decrease from its original setting to 60% in setting cycle time, and then increased from 60% to its original setting in the nest setting cycle time. In this program, pulse rate (1 to 150Hz), pulse width (50 to 300µS) and cycle time (5 to 30 sec) are fully adjustable.

Technical Specifications for Microcurrent (MIC) Mode

Waveform Mono-phase square pulse wave
Pulse Amplitude Adjustable 0~0.7mA; peak at 1000 ohm load each channel,

0.01mA/step
**** Pulse Rate (P.R.)| Adjustable from 0.1Hz to 150Hz; there into, 0.1Hz/step in the range of 0.1Hz~2Hz, 1Hz/step in the range of 2Hz ~150Hz.


Pulse Width (P.W.)| Adjustable (in correlation to the Pulse Rate), from 2 to 200ms, 1ms/step
Constant (N)| Constant stimulation based on setting value. Only pulse width, pulse rate and timer are adjustable in this program. “Constant” is equal to the “Normal” mode of a TENS therapeutic mode.
Pulse Width Modulation (M)| The pulse width is automatically varied in a cycle time. The pulse width is decreased from its original setting to 60% in the setting cycle time, and then increased from 60% to its original setting in the next setting cycle time. In this program, pulse rate (0.1 to 150Hz), pulse width (2 to 200ms) and cycle time (5 to 30 sec) are fully adjustable.
****
Pulse Rate Modulation (M1)| The pulse rate is automatically varied in a cycle time. The pulse rate is decreased from its original setting to 60% in setting cycle time, and then increased from 60% to its original setting in the next setting cycle time. In this program, pulse rate (0.1 to 150 Hz), pulse width (2 to 200ms) and cycle time (5 to 30 sec) are fully adjustable.

Tips for Skin Care
Follow these suggestions to avoid skin irritation, especially if you have sensitive skin:

  1. Wash the area of skin you will be placing the electrodes on with soap. Rinse thoroughly and dry the area completely before and after placing electrodes.
  2. Excess hair may be clipped with scissors; do not shave stimulation area.
  3. Wipe the area with the skin preparation your clinician has recommended. Let this dry. Apply electrodes as directed.
  4. Many skin problems arise from the “pulling stress” from adhesive patches that are excessively stretched across the skin during application. To prevent this, apply electrodes from center outward; avoid stretching over the skin.
  5. To minimize “pulling stress”, tape extra lengths of lead wires to the skin in a loop to prevent tugging on electrodes.
  6. When removing electrodes, always remove by pulling in the direction of hair growth.
  7. It may be helpful to rub skin lotion on electrode placement area during treatment down time when you are not wearing electrodes.
  8. Never apply electrodes over irritated or broken skin.
